Transponder Chip Replacement
Transponder chips are the special components in your car keys that communicate wirelessly with your car whenever you insert them in the ignition. This makes sure that only your key is able to start the car and prevents unauthorized access to your vehicle. However, the chips could be damaged and you will need to call an auto locksmith who is reliable to repair them.
Transponder chips are needed for modern cars that have key repair shop near me fobs and remote keyless entry systems. Keys with transponder chips are more advanced than basic keys made of metal. They have a a thicker head with less carved out grooves. A NYC transponder-key specialist can remove the head of your key and insert a brand new one with an integrated chip. They'll then reprogram the key to work with the system of your vehicle.
If you have an older model of car and don't require an ignition key or a switchblade key, a locksmith will probably be able to design a basic metal car key. This type of car key can be created more easily and at a lower cost than the repair of keys with chip-based keys.

key repair shop near me Programming
The next step, key programming, is an essential step which ensures that the new keys function in tandem with your vehicle. A car key repair specialist's expertise is really tested in this case. They will open your fob and replace the transponder with a new chip that works with your vehicle. They'll then program it to perform all of its functions from opening doors to starting your engine.
It sounds complicated It may sound difficult, but it's actually easy. Haresh Gobin is a product manager for Launch Tech USA. He states that the key and vehicle must "know each other," similar to a dating application. "There's a procedure for doing that, and that's what the Tasker will accomplish."
To begin, they'll require a blank key, that you can buy on the internet or from a local locksmith. Also, they'll require the correct scanner and set key cutting tools. If they're working on the Ford for instance they might need to utilize a bidirectional OBD-II scanner such as XToolUSA's Nitro or a EEPROM programmer such as their AutoPro Pad.
If the tasker is equipped with the right tools, they'll be able to get the job done in a flash. They could be able to program a key within a minute in the event that they follow the proper steps.
One thing to be aware of is that not all key fobs are programmed in exactly the same way. This is why it's crucial to choose a Tasker that has the knowledge and experience to know what they're doing.
